7 Must-Have Features in Your Digital Business Card
Not all digital cards are created equal. After testing 12 platforms, here’s what separates the best digital business card solutions from the rest:
- NFC compatibility (enables tap-to-share via smartphones)
- CRM integrations (auto-saves contacts to Salesforce or HubSpot)
- Customizable analytics (track views, saves, and geographic data)
- Offline mode (works without internet via Bluetooth)
- Multi-platform sharing (SMS, email, social media, QR codes)
- Password protection (for sensitive client information)
- Team management (centralized branding for employees)

How to Create Your Digital Business Card in 10 Minutes
Ready to build your powerhouse card? Follow this battle-tested process:
- Choose your platform: For NFC capabilities, XAPS leads the pack (see our NFC business card comparison)
- Input core details: Name, headline, contact info, social links
- Add dynamic elements: Video intro, product catalog, appointment scheduler
- Design strategically: Use high-contrast colors and minimal text (scans better)
- Test thoroughly: Check all links and sharing methods
Common Mistake: Overloading your card with info. Stick to 3 priority actions (call, email, portfolio view).

2. What if the recipient doesn’t have the app?
The best digital business card solutions create universal web links that open in any browser. NFC cards also work through standard smartphone settings—no special app needed for the recipient.
